Last week, in reading students reviewed different text features such as understanding bold words and reading a glossary. They also worked on how to read a non-fiction story by practicing different expressions. The changed their voice when asking a question or change their volume when something exciting was happening.
In writing, students worked on writing a introduction and conclusion in their books. They also spent time reviewing how to plan and make a new book. Trying to decide the different types of pages is a small adventure in first grade. Finally we worked on elaborating our stories by creating twin sentences. For example: A porcupine has quills. Quills are small spikes used to protect itself from predators.
In Math, we worked on adding 2 digit numbers. We learned how to use base ten block to create a new 10. Then we drew it using quick tens and ones and showed are thinking using the arrow way. We learned how to notate our thinking by decomposing the ones in order to make the two digit number into an easily added 10.
We started a new Science Unit, Plants and Animals. We went on a plant hunt around the school and discovered different kinds of plants. Then we investigated the parts of a plant but cutting up an onion. Finally we compared parts of a plant using an onion and celery.
